An Interview with TimePassages author Henry Seltzer
Henry, what are your three favorite features in TimePassages?
The ease of use is very important. I want speed when I'm working with a client. So I like being able to go back and forth from the Natal chart to the Transiting bi-wheel and the progressions easily. Also it is very handy to see how close an aspect is (and whether applying or separating) by putting the mouse on it. The quality of the graphics and the use of meaningful color is also quite important to me and how the closer aspects stand out when looking at the chart. Then, for others, the Chiron interpretations have gotten a lot of attention, in their writing style and accuracy. In general, the interpretations that I have written have been extremely well-received, and that's enormously gratifying to me. I've even had the honor of being told that these interpretations 'change people's lives.'
How did you get into the business of building astrology software?
I was doing a lot of astrology and wasn't satisfied with any of the current software. This was back in 1985 so there wasn't the variety that we have today. I started building for the Macintosh and switched to Windows when it became more popular. Today we are the only Western astrology software that runs on both Windows and Mac!
Are there any areas of astrology that hold a special appeal to you and thus may be covered in extra depth in your program?
I would have to say Chiron, as far as interpreting the chart. I think that Chiron is a very significant chart factor, as necessary for getting the picture as the outer planets! I really think we have 11 significant planetary factors including Chiron. TimePassages optionally includes Chiron in the planetary patterns that we analyze automatically like the 'bowl' or the 'funnel' chart shapes.
